Crusader Allison Azevedo earns high praise in Central Valley volleyball as she earns league Most Valuable Player
Martha Azevedo (Allison’s Mom) – “Allison gives 100% to everything she puts her mind to in sports, academics, and following Jesus,” said Azevedo’s mother, Martha. “She has been a student at Kings Christian School since pre-kindergarten and has made lifelong friendships. As her parents, we’ve always reminded her ‘oh the mountains you can move’ when Jesus is directing your path.”
Principal Kevin Dalafu added: “Seeing Allison on the Volleyball Fabulous 40 list is not a surprise. She has always been a fantastic volleyball player and works very hard at her craft. Not only is she a leader on the court, but Allison is also the President of the High School Student Leadership Team. We look forward to seeing how God uses her in the future.”
The Crusaders’ head coach, Todd Martin also had positive words for her star volleyball player. “Since her freshman year, Allison has had a mindset to grow and improve as a player. She was always open to instruction and ways to improve each aspect of her game. This continued growth was evident throughout her high school years and led to her achievements this season both as an individual player and a team member.”
